Why do people rent Sprinter vans?

People rent Sprinter vans for a variety of different purposes. For one, they offer a more spacious option than a regular passenger car, making them ideal for larger groups of people. They can also be used to transport large items that wouldn’t fit in a standard car.

Business owners with limited vehicle fleets may rent Sprinter vans for deliveries and transport of materials and equipment. Sprinter vans have added features like side sliding doors, rear doors with windows, and tie down hooks that make them ideal for hauling items and tools.

For families going on vacation, a Sprinter van offers them the ability to bring larger items like strollers and loads of luggage, plus extra space for comfort during the ride. Sprinters are also being used as mobile offices, with compartments for computers and other office supplies, shelving systems, and tables.

What are Mercedes Sprinters used for?

Mercedes Sprinters are versatile vehicles that can be used for a variety of purposes. Generally, they are used as cargo vans, passenger vans, and recreational vehicles. As cargo vans, they are most commonly used for passenger or freight transportation, or as a delivery vehicle.

They often feature a comfortable driver’s seat, power locks, and a large cargo space. As passenger vans, they are ideal for accommodating large groups, such as for business trips, church outings, or long road trips.

As recreational vehicles, they can provide a comfortable environment when camping or traveling. With customized features such as a kitchen, sleeping quarters, a bathroom, and even an entertainment area, Sprinters make an excellent weekend escape vehicle.

Additionally, they are being increasingly used by medical providers, such as ambulance crews, due to their range in size.

Does a Sprinter van have a toilet?

No, Sprinter vans do not come with built-in toilets. Some companies may offer a customized Sprinter van that includes a toilet, but these would likely be converted camper-style vans, which are not your standard delivery or cargo vans.

If you need a portable toilet in your Sprinter, you could potentially install a removable toilet that fits inside your van, but this is not a common option. For long trips, it is recommended to make frequent stops to access public restrooms.

How do I get loads for my Sprinter van?

One of the most popular methods is to use a freight shipping platform or truck load board. These sites are like classifieds for shipping and you can search for loads that fit your vehicle’s specifications.

You can also sign up for notifications so that when a load pops up in your area or with your criteria, you get notified immediately.

You can also network with people in different transportation industries and stay in touch with them for loads. Finding people who have a similar route to you or work well with Sprinter vans will be beneficial.

This could include cargo brokers, other Sprinter van owners, or delivery companies that are used to dealing with Sprinter vans.

You should also consider setting up a website or unbranded profile with your contact information and specifications of the type of loads you are able to carry, so people can find you. Additionally, talking to local businesses in industries that handle frequent deliveries, such as florists, catering companies, pet foods and more, can also be a great way to find and develop lasting relationships that get daily loads.

Finally, you can use online marketplace sites and classifieds to post yourself and your services and find local customers who are in need of deliveries. With the right combination of these strategies, you can find the loads you need for your Sprinter van and make sure you keep busy.
